文件是数据库存储数据的基础组件,占据核心地位。深入分析其重要性,文件在数据库中扮演着关键角色,确保数据的安全、高效和可管理。
本文目录导读:
随着信息技术的飞速发展,数据库已成为现代社会信息存储、管理和处理的重要工具,文件作为数据库存储数据的基本组件,其重要性不言而喻,本文将从文件在数据库存储中的核心地位、文件类型、存储方式以及文件优化等方面进行深入探讨。
图片来源于网络,如有侵权联系删除
文件在数据库存储中的核心地位
1、数据存储的载体
数据库中的数据需要存储在某种介质上,而文件便是这种介质,文件可以将大量数据有序地存储在计算机硬盘、光盘等存储设备上,为数据库提供稳定的数据存储基础。
2、数据交换的媒介
在数据库系统中,数据交换和共享是必不可少的,文件作为一种通用的数据格式,便于不同数据库之间的数据交换和共享,通过文件,用户可以轻松地将数据导入或导出数据库,实现数据资源的最大化利用。
3、数据管理的依据
文件在数据库存储中承载着数据管理的重要信息,文件名、目录结构、文件大小、创建时间等属性,为数据库管理系统提供了数据管理的依据,通过对文件的合理组织和管理,可以提高数据库的性能和稳定性。
文件类型及存储方式
1、文件类型
数据库中常见的文件类型包括:
(1)文本文件:以文本格式存储数据,如.txt、.csv等。
图片来源于网络,如有侵权联系删除
(2)二进制文件:以二进制格式存储数据,如.bin、.dbf等。
(3)数据库文件:专门用于存储数据库数据的文件,如MySQL的.bin文件、Oracle的.dbf文件等。
2、存储方式
(1)顺序存储:将数据按照一定的顺序存储在文件中,如文本文件。
(2)链式存储:将数据以链表的形式存储在文件中,如二进制文件。
(3)索引存储:在文件中建立索引,以便快速查找数据,如数据库文件。
文件优化
1、文件压缩
为了提高文件存储效率,可以对文件进行压缩,常用的压缩算法有gzip、zip等,压缩后的文件体积减小,便于存储和传输。
2、文件分割
图片来源于网络,如有侵权联系删除
对于大数据量的文件,可以将其分割成多个小文件,以便于管理和维护,分割后的文件可以分别存储在不同的存储设备上,提高数据的安全性。
3、文件加密
为了保护文件数据的安全,可以对文件进行加密,常用的加密算法有AES、DES等,加密后的文件只有经过解密才能访问,有效防止数据泄露。
4、文件备份
定期对文件进行备份,可以防止数据丢失,备份的方式有全备份、增量备份、差异备份等,根据实际需求选择合适的备份策略,确保数据安全。
文件作为数据库存储数据的基本组件,在数据库系统中扮演着至关重要的角色,了解文件在数据库存储中的核心地位、文件类型、存储方式以及文件优化等方面,有助于提高数据库的性能和稳定性,为用户提供优质的数据服务。
标签: #数据存储核心
评论列表